1. Join HIV-Specific Dating Sites
One of the most straightforward ways to meet HIV positive singles is by joining HIV-specific dating sites. Platforms like Positive Singles, HIV Dating, and POZ Personals cater specifically to people living with HIV. These sites provide a safe space where members can connect without the anxiety of disclosing their status.

3. Participate in HIV Positive Forums
Online forums like those on Reddit, POZ Community Forums, or even specific Facebook groups offer a place to meet and interact with HIV positive singles. These forums allow you to share experiences, ask questions, and meet people in a more relaxed, community-focused setting.
4. Attend Virtual HIV Support Groups
Many organizations offer virtual support groups for people living with HIV. These groups often foster a sense of community, and through regular interaction, you may meet someone who shares your interests and values. Check out platforms like Meetup or local HIV organizations for virtual events.
5. Leverage Social Media Platforms
Social media platforms like Instagram, Twitter, and Facebook are powerful tools for connecting with others. Follow HIV advocacy pages, join relevant groups, or participate in discussions to meet people who understand your journey. Use hashtags like #HIVPositive or #LivingWithHIV to find communities and individuals.
6. Try Online HIV Dating Events
Some organizations and dating platforms host online events specifically for HIV positive singles. These events may include virtual speed dating, webinars, or social gatherings, providing a structured yet fun way to meet new people.
7. Explore HIV Positive Blogs and Communities
There are numerous blogs and online communities created by and for people living with HIV. These platforms often feature comment sections, forums, or member directories where you can connect with others. Sites like TheBody and A Girl Like Me offer rich content and vibrant communities.
8. Engage in HIV Positive Chat Rooms
Chat rooms dedicated to HIV positive individuals can be a great way to meet singles. Websites like Positive Singles and HIVNet offer chat rooms where you can engage in real-time conversations, making it easier to build connections.
9. Use Specialized HIV Dating Apps
In addition to websites, there are specialized dating apps for HIV positive singles. Apps like Hzone are designed specifically for HIV positive individuals, providing a convenient way to meet others on the go. These apps often have features like instant messaging, which can help you connect quickly.
10. Network Through Online HIV Advocacy Groups
Many HIV advocacy groups have online communities where you can meet like-minded individuals. These groups often organize virtual events, discussion boards, and social media pages that allow you to connect with others who are passionate about HIV awareness and support.
